- Push the carpet tabs to one side to access the rubber grommet in the cowl panel.
- Remove the rubber grommet.






Note! Applies to cars with parking heaters Protect the coolant hose on the horizontal connection of the water pump when making the markings for holes.

- Pierce holes through the heat insulation panel and out into the engine compartment, for hole-marking in the heat insulation panel in the engine compartment.





- Raise the car.
- Cut out a hole in the heat insulation that is approx. 20 mm (25/32".) larger than the size of the rubber grommet.





- Take the rubber grommet from the kit and cut the top off the smaller rubber nipples
- Lubricate the rubber grommet. Use low temperature grease (P/N 1161417).
- Thread the rubber grommet on the cable harness.
- Route the cable harness in through the hole and press the rubber grommet into the hole so that it seals properly.
- Pull the cable harness so that the correct length remains in the engine compartment.
- Make sure that the heating hose for the cable harness is in contact against the rubber grommet and secure it with a tie strap.





- Lower the car.
- Release the catch on the connector that was taped.
- Connect the pre-routed cable harness terminals in the connector as follows.
1. 1 Blue (BL)
2. 2 Green (GN)
3. 3 Violet (VO)
4. 4 Yellow (Y)
5. 5 White (W)
6. 6 Black (SB)
- Press back the connector's catch.





- Take the long cable harness from the kit. Connect it to the connector which has just been prepared.
- Route the cable harness from the lower edge of the A pillar and further back at the sill and under the carpet.
- Fold back the carpet and screw the clip into place.






Note! Applies to left-hand drive cars

- Route the cable harness further back and under the seat support and backwards and into the cargo compartment, along the existing cable harnesses.
- Position the cable harness so that it does not get trapped or damaged.






Note! Applies to right-hand drive cars

- Route the cable harness from the lower edge of the A pillar and further back under the carpet and behind the large side panel.






Note! Applies to right-hand drive cars

- Route the cable harness under the floor's insulation panel over to the right-hand side.





- Route the cable further along the existing cable harnesses backwards and into the cargo compartment, to the right rear corner of the cargo floor support.
- Position the cable so that is does not get trapped or damaged.





- Lift up the right-hand side cargo floor support.
- Locate the parking assistance module (PAM). It is secured on the right-hand side of the cargo compartment floor, under the cargo floor support.
